Title: DocLint false-positives on fenced plugin examples

DocLint 2.9 flags valid fenced code blocks in plugin manifests as "unclosed admonition," breaking CI for several external authors targeting the Pinwheel registry. Repro: any manifest with a nested example block under a `usage:` heading. Workaround: pin DocLint 2.8 or disable rule A041. Fix is merged and will ship in the next point release; plugin authors should re-run validation after upgrading. To confirm you are on the patched build, check the token below.

build token for kagaf-hahof: htk14_9d3d4d26d7d8de

Runbook: Replica Lag Alarm — Ostwick Ledger

When the lag alarm fires, confirm the replica is more than 90 seconds behind before acting. Check the replication slot status and WAL volume on the primary first; most incidents are bulk imports, not faults. If lag persists past 15 minutes, failover review is required. To inspect the replica directly, use this connection string.

warehouse DSN: mssql://rusdor_svc:0FSWCn9@db-951a.paliqforge.local:5432/ulawyn

Handing off the Corvid parcel-tracking webhook. Plugin authors: events arrive as signed JSON, one per scan event, retried with backoff for 24 hours. Dedupe on the event token — carriers like Pellworth Logistics resend aggressively. Failures over 1% page the Marrow team. Register your receiver with the values below.

deployment values, kajep-kageg:
[praix]
host = praix.paliqcorp.corp
user = praix_svc
database = praix_prod

Effective next quarter, discounts on deals above the large-deal threshold for the Ardent platform require dual approval: regional finance lead plus deal desk. Standard ceiling moves from 20% to 18%, with exceptions documented in the Quorum tracker. Historical data shows large-deal margins eroded three points over the past year, mostly from uncapped services bundling. Services discounts are now capped separately at 10%. Questions go to Lena Prust's team before month-end. The confidential business-plans note follows immediately below.

internal memo for hahaf-kahof: Only 39 of the 428 pilot accounts renewed Sorion, so a churn review is set for April 12. Praokix Freight is in early talks to buy Queniusox Group for about $145.8 million.